Impressions of Maquillage....
a very soft and wearable violet-rose
with occasional hints of vanilla and cookies on me (are those really in there?).
Easier to wear for many purposes than FM Lipstick Rose,
EL Beautiful, Lolita Lempicka, MJ Violet (i.e. other
violet-rose, violet-vanilla scents). I like it! :-)))
